The next Fortnite update on May8th will have quite a few changes for the game. A new Lightsaber, force power, and character, Mace Windu, will be added into the game as a new addition. He’ll be a training character you go to when getting a lightsaber. Players will also be able to use the Force Pull power, which we’ve seen in past updates. On the dark side of things, Darth Maul will also be available; they’ll have a Force Throw power which lets you launch things at other players.

The excitement doesn’t stop there, as there are some extra Fortnite NPC locations being added this week too. We’ll get Luke, Leia, and Han Solo on the map as NPCs you can interact with. The next Fortnite update after May8th will be the Chewbacca update, coming on May15th. It brings Chewbacca into the game along with his Wookie Bowcaster, like we saw last year. A new shotgun blaster is also due to be added to the game.

The update on May22nd will bring a new Mandalorian set of characters to the game. These will be available in all the normal forms, a heavy, a scout, a supply, and medic. Each will have a slightly different design. There will also be the Mandalorian Sniper rifle returning to the game, and a new blaster. For one of the final Fortnite updates of the season, there is Star Destroyer Bombardment. This is similar to the boss transformations we’ve had in some past seasons.

The final Fortnite update of the mini-season comes on June7th, and it’s a live event which will see the end of the season out. We don’t expect too many gameplay changes here, since it’ll move us into the next Fortnite season. The uncertainty of what’s to come has players eagerly waiting. The other game modes, Rocket Racing and Fortnite Festival, also have different update schedules. Rocket Racing doesn’t have seasons or updates anymore, so the answer to the next update here is probably never. Fortnite Festival, on the other hand, is a bit different. It has Festival Passes which run on its own schedule. These have been arriving every two months. New tracks, on the other hand, are cycled in daily! This is a rotation for songs in use, and we get updates on Tuesday like the other modes to expand the overall pool of songs. The next Festival season will start in the next Fortnite season, then we’ll have quite a while to wait for the next one.
